Are constitutional isomers the same as stereoisomers?
Structural (constitutional) isomers have the same molecular formula but a different bonding arrangement among the atoms. Stereoisomers have identical molecular formulas and arrangements of atoms. They differ from each other only in the spatial orientation of groups in the molecule.
How many structural isomers are possible for C3H4?
There are three structural isomers of C3H4 , propadiene, propyne, and cyclopropene. They all have at least one double bond between carbon atoms, and one has triple bonds between carbon atoms.

What is the difference between constitutional and geometric isomers?
Geometric Isomers vs Structural Isomers Isomers can be mainly divided into two groups as constitutional isomers and stereoisomers. Constitutional isomers are isomers where the connectivity of atoms differs in molecules. In stereoisomers atoms are connected in the same sequence, unlike constitutional isomers.

What is the difference between Stereoisomerism and optical isomerism?
Structural isomers atoms are bound in different orders while stereoisomers are bound in the same order but oriented differently. Geometric isomers involve different arrangement about a double bond. Optical isomers involve four groups in varying arrangements around a central atom.
